Performance Differences Between MINI JCW and Mini Cooper S
When it comes to performance, the MINI JCW and Mini Cooper S are two of the most popular models in the MINI lineup. While they may look similar on the outside, there are some key differences between the two that set them apart in terms of performance.
One of the biggest differences between the MINI JCW and Mini Cooper S is the engine. The MINI JCW is powered by a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ine that produces 228 horsepower and 236 lb-ft of torque. The Mini Cooper S, on the other hand, is powered by a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ine that produces 189 horsepower and 207 lb-ft of torque. This means that the MINI JCW has a significant power advantage over the Mini Cooper S.
Another difference between the two models is the suspension. The MINI JCW has a sport-tuned suspension that is designed to provide a more responsive and agile driving experience. The Mini Cooper S, on the other hand, has a more comfort-oriented suspension that is designed to provide a smoother ride. This means that the MINI JCW is better suited for drivers who want a more engaging driving experience, while the Mini Cooper S is better suited for drivers who prioritize comfort.
In addition to the engine and suspension, the MINI JCW and Mini Cooper S also differ in terms of their brakes. The MINI JCW has larger brakes than the Mini Cooper S, which means that it is better equipped to handle high-speed driving and aggressive braking. This is particularly important for drivers who plan to take their MINI JCW to the track or engage in spirited driving.
Another performance difference between the two models is the transmission. The MINI JCW comes standard with a six-speed manual transmission, while the Mini Cooper S comes standard with a six-speed automatic transmission. While both transmissions are capable of delivering a fun and engaging driving experience, the manual transmission in the MINI JCW is better suited for drivers who want to have more control over their driving experience.
Finally, the MINI JCW and Mini Cooper S differ in terms of their exhaust systems. The MINI JCW has a sport-tuned exhaust system that produces a more aggressive and sporty sound, while the Mini Cooper S has a more subdued exhaust system that is designed to provide a quieter driving experience. This means that the MINI JCW is better suited for drivers who want to make a statement with their car, while the Mini Cooper S is better suited for drivers who prefer a more understated driving experience.

Exterior Design Features of MINI JCW vs. Mini Cooper S
When it comes to the MINI brand, there are a lot of different models to choose from. Two of the most popular options are the MINI JCW and the Mini Cooper S. While these two cars may look similar at first glance, there are actually quite a few differences between them. In this article, we’ll take a closer look at the exterior design features of the MINI JCW and the Mini Cooper S to help you understand just how different these two cars really are.
One of the most obvious differences between the MINI JCW and the Mini Cooper S is the styling. While both cars have a similar overall shape, the JCW has a more aggressive look to it. This is thanks in part to the larger air intakes in the front bumper, which help to cool the engine and brakes. The JCW also has a unique rear spoiler that helps to improve downforce at high speeds.
Another key difference between the two cars is the wheels. The MINI JCW comes standard with 18-inch alloy wheels, while the Mini Cooper S has 16-inch wheels. The larger wheels on the JCW not only look more impressive, but they also help to improve handling and grip on the road.
Moving on to the headlights, the MINI JCW has LED headlights as standard, while the Mini Cooper S has halogen headlights. LED headlights are brighter and more energy-efficient than halogen headlights, which means that they provide better visibility while using less power. The JCW also has a unique lighting signature that sets it apart from other MINI models.
When it comes to the grille, the MINI JCW has a more aggressive design than the Mini Cooper S. The JCW has a larger grille with a honeycomb pattern, which helps to improve airflow to the engine. The Mini Cooper S, on the other hand, has a smaller grille with a more traditional design.
Moving on to the side of the car, the MINI JCW has unique side skirts that help to improve aerodynamics. These side skirts also give the car a more sporty look. The Mini Cooper S, on the other hand, has more traditional side skirts that are less noticeable.
Finally, let’s take a look at the rear of the car. The MINI JCW has a unique rear bumper with a diffuser that helps to improve airflow and reduce drag. The JCW also has a unique exhaust system that gives it a more aggressive sound. The Mini Cooper S, on the other hand, has a more traditional rear bumper and exhaust system.

Price Comparison of MINI JCW and Mini Cooper S Models
When it comes to buying a car, one of the most important factors to consider is the price. This is especially true when comparing two similar models, such as the MINI JCW and the Mini Cooper S. While both cars are part of the MINI family, they have some key differences that can affect their price points.
First, let’s take a look at the MINI JCW. This car is the top-of-the-line model in the MINI lineup, and it comes with a price tag to match. The base price for a 2021 MINI JCW is $33,900, which is significantly higher than the base price for a Mini Cooper S. However, this price does come with some added features that you won’t find on the Cooper S.
For starters, the MINI JCW comes with a more powerful engine. It has a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ine that produces 228 horsepower and 236 lb-ft of torque. This is a significant increase over the Cooper S, which has a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ine that produces 189 horsepower and 207 lb-ft of torque. The JCW also comes with a sport-tuned suspension, larger brakes, and a sport exhaust system, all of which contribute to its higher price point.
In addition to its performance upgrades, the MINI JCW also comes with a number of luxury features that are not available on the Cooper S. These include leather upholstery, a panoramic sunroof, and a Harman Kardon sound system. While these features may not be essential for everyone, they do add to the overall driving experience and can make the JCW feel more like a premium car.
So, what about the Mini Cooper S? While it may not have all the bells and whistles of the JCW, it is still a great car in its own right. The base price for a 2021 Mini Cooper S is $28,750, which is significantly lower than the JCW. However, this price does come with some compromises.
As mentioned earlier, the Cooper S has a less powerful engine than the JCW. It also has a less sporty suspension and smaller brakes.
